A Brief History
The very first slot machine, invented by Charles Fey in 1895, was called the Liberty Bell. It featured three reels and a handful of symbols, including horseshoes, bells, and playing cards. Players would pull a lever to set the reels in motion, hoping to line up matching symbols. The simplicity and excitement of this game quickly made it popular across bars and casinos.
Transition to the Digital Age
With the rise of technology, slot machines gradually moved from mechanical to electronic and then to fully digital systems. Online slots emerged in the 1990s, offering players the chance to spin reels from the comfort of their homes. Today, online casinos host thousands of slot games, each with unique themes, graphics, and bonus features.

The Role of Technology
Modern slots use advanced algorithms called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ure fair play. Developers also integrate high-quality graphics, immersive sound effects, and engaging storylines. Many online platforms now offer mobile-friendly versions, making it possible to enjoy slots anywhere, anytime.
